@echooff Rem ============================================================================== Rem 备份cacti数据库 Rem perfectaction Rem 用户名 set User=root Rem 密码 set pwd=Abc.123 Rem 数据库名称 set database_name=cacti Rem 备份路径 set backup_path=D:\cacti_mysql_bak\cacti_bak\ Rem 获取当前系统时间字符串,适用于win2003中文版或是安装了东方语言包的win2003英文版 set now=%date:~0,4%%date:~5,2%%date:~8,2%_%time:~0,2%%time:~3,2%%time:~6,2% Rem mysqldump安装目录 set mysqldump_Path="C:\Program Files\MySQL\MySQL Server 5.0\bin\" Rem 执行备份命令 %mysqldump_Path%mysqldump -u%User% -p%pwd% %database_name%>%backup_path%%database_name%_%now%_bak.sql Rem ============================================================================== Rem ============================================================================== Rem 删除过期cacti备份,只保留一个月 forfiles /p %backup_path% /s /m *.* /d -31/c "cmd /c del @file" Rem ============================================================================== Rem ============================================================================== Rem 备份rrd文件 copy C:\Apache2\htdocs\cacti\rra\*.* D:\cacti_mysql_bak\rra_bak\/y Rem ============================================================================== Rem pause
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】凌霞软件回馈社区,博客园 & 1Panel & Halo 联合会员上线
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】博客园社区专享云产品让利特惠,阿里云新客6.5折上折
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步